titleOfInvention | Organic silicon adhesive for packaging ultraviolet LED chip |
abstract | The invention relates to an organic silicon adhesive for packaging an ultraviolet LED chip, which comprises the following components: 40-50 parts of methyl vinyl silicone resin, 0.01-0.03 part of platinum catalyst, 3-5 parts of binder, 20-30 parts of methyl hydrogen-containing MQ silicone resin, 10-20 parts of epoxy acrylic acid modified hydrogen-containing silicone oil and 0.1-0.2 part of inhibitor. The invention has the beneficial effects that: the high-temperature-resistant retention rate of the packaging glue provided by the invention can be kept above 90%, the ultraviolet resistance is 14-15% higher than that of the common glue, the ultraviolet-resistant effect can be better achieved, and the light attenuation of a light attenuation test of 1000H can meet the international lighting standard within 5%. |
